Hey Gene,

We were talking 2 stage blowers. Here is a few pictures of what I did to mine.

1. Auger shaft bearing. I replaced the original bronze bushing with ball bearing cam lock units. The shaft is 1" dia.





You need a 1/4" to 5/16" spacer to move the bearing in board as the auger shaft is too short. The spacer also clears the bearing flange.

2. Tensioner. I really hated the oringal wood block chain tensioner. So I replaced it with this.



I used the original bracket and extended it downward so the idler sprocket would clear the frame.

Links to the bearings at TSC. Most bearing houses have them

Flanges - T52MSTR

www.tractorsupply.com/tsc/product/a-l-be...m-119871799--1?rfk=1

Bearings - SA205-16

www.tractorsupply.com/tsc/product/insert...16-1-in?cm_vc=-10005

This is the same type of bearing that are used on the single stage jack shafts and the two stage impeller shaft. Just different shaft diameters.

I usually get my bearings from USA Bearings and Belts, but have used TSC bearing with good results.

Some more bearing pics.




Yes I did machine the spacer.

Drawing for the spacer - The last spacer I made the large inside diameter had to be 2-1/8" to clear the flange.
